Displaying Olfactory Receptors of the Mouse

Symbols to the mouse and rat OR repertoires were assigned using the Mutual Maximum Similarity (MMS) algorithm, a systematic human-based classifier. Mutual-best-hits are first identified and assigned the symbol of the human best match gene, provided that their similarity is >=80%. At a second stage, the algorithm searches for additional orthology candidates with highest similarity to their human partner (>=80%), by allowing more than a single ortholog. The mouse and rat OR symbols , such as Or10aa4-ps, use the Or root and indicate the gene is "olfactory receptor family10 subfamily aa member 4", with the optional "ps" suffix to indicate a pseudogene. The symbols for candidate co-orthologs are, for example, Or10d4, Or10d4b and Or10d4c, with Or10d4 being the mutual-best-hit.
